Въпрос за Excel
Правила на форума
Натисни тук за да прочетеш Правилата на форума
Натисни тук за да прочетеш Правилата на форума
- filipov
- Мнения: 402
- Регистриран на: Сря 12 мар 2008 18:10
- Автомобил:
- Двигател:
- Местоположение: София
- Контакти:
Въпрос за Excel
Може ли някой да ми каже как информацията от два екселски файла/sheet/ мога да я сравня за дублиране? Или може ли текстовата информация от двата файла/sheet/ да се обедини в един като се остане само единия запис?
Re: Въпрос за Excel
не ми е ясно какво точно искаш да направиш, но принципно може да се сравняват и "обединяват" клетки, които имат еднакво съдържание (дословно еднакво и форматирано). Методи и начини различни, кажи или най-добре дай пример точно какво искаш да постигнеш.
- bobo7
- форумно КГБ
- Мнения: 9453
- Регистриран на: Чет 16 юни 2005 20:43
- Автомобил:
- Двигател: AGN
- Местоположение: София
- Контакти:
Re: Въпрос за Excel
да съпостави числата вътре в А2 с Б2 и надоло....
Re: Въпрос за Excel
тва е лесно, единия начин, за който се сещам е VLOOKUP
едните числа са ти в А колона на sheet1, другите в А колона на sheet2.
В[във] "В"[бе] колона на sheet1 по цялата дължина на колона А (там където има стойности), слагаш тази формула:
=VLOOKUP(A1;Sheet2!A:B;2;FALSE)
там където има съвпадение ще излезе 0 или ще стои празно
там където няма - ще излезе #N/A
Същото можеш да го направиш и в обратна посока, да сортираш, филтрираш редове и да триеш такива, които не ти харесват, повтарят се и тн. Тази формула важи за всякакви стойности в A (числа, букви, дати), стига да са изписани и форматирани еднакво в двете таблици.
Същото може да се приложи и за информация в различни файлове, но ако искаш да си запазиш информацията в новата В[бе] колона, ще трябва да я copy/paste - special - values, защото в противен случай ако остане като формула и затвориш другия файл, или промениш данните в колоната, с която сравняваш, инфото в В[бе] ще изчезне или промени, защото формулата ще продължи да се изпълнява.
едните числа са ти в А колона на sheet1, другите в А колона на sheet2.
В[във] "В"[бе] колона на sheet1 по цялата дължина на колона А (там където има стойности), слагаш тази формула:
=VLOOKUP(A1;Sheet2!A:B;2;FALSE)
там където има съвпадение ще излезе 0 или ще стои празно
там където няма - ще излезе #N/A
Същото можеш да го направиш и в обратна посока, да сортираш, филтрираш редове и да триеш такива, които не ти харесват, повтарят се и тн. Тази формула важи за всякакви стойности в A (числа, букви, дати), стига да са изписани и форматирани еднакво в двете таблици.
Същото може да се приложи и за информация в различни файлове, но ако искаш да си запазиш информацията в новата В[бе] колона, ще трябва да я copy/paste - special - values, защото в противен случай ако остане като формула и затвориш другия файл, или промениш данните в колоната, с която сравняваш, инфото в В[бе] ще изчезне или промени, защото формулата ще продължи да се изпълнява.
- Милослав
- Мнения: 3648
- Регистриран на: Сря 29 мар 2006 11:19
- Автомобил:
- Двигател:
- Местоположение: София
- Контакти:
Re: Въпрос за Excel
Може и с MATCH
- filipov
- Мнения: 402
- Регистриран на: Сря 12 мар 2008 18:10
- Автомобил:
- Двигател:
- Местоположение: София
- Контакти:
Re: Въпрос за Excel
VWGT написа:тва е лесно, единия начин, за който се сещам е VLOOKUP
едните числа са ти в А колона на sheet1, другите в А колона на sheet2.
В[във] "В"[бе] колона на sheet1 по цялата дължина на колона А (там където има стойности), слагаш тази формула:
=VLOOKUP(A1;Sheet2!A:B;2;FALSE)
там където има съвпадение ще излезе 0 или ще стои празно
там където няма - ще излезе #N/A
Същото можеш да го направиш и в обратна посока, да сортираш, филтрираш редове и да триеш такива, които не ти харесват, повтарят се и тн. Тази формула важи за всякакви стойности в A (числа, букви, дати), стига да са изписани и форматирани еднакво в двете таблици.
Същото може да се приложи и за информация в различни файлове, но ако искаш да си запазиш информацията в новата В[бе] колона, ще трябва да я copy/paste - special - values, защото в противен случай ако остане като формула и затвориш другия файл, или промениш данните в колоната, с която сравняваш, инфото в В[бе] ще изчезне или промени, защото формулата ще продължи да се изпълнява.
Нещо такова искам да направя, но не ми стана много ясно с това "special - values". Искам след като сравня двата sheet -a повтаряемата информация /в случая текст или цифри/ да отпадне като остане само от единия sheet, а там където няма повторения си остава. Само да вмъкна, че става въпрос за сравнение на sheet с около 30000 реда и 7 колони.
Re: Въпрос за Excel
Не че става много ясно какво точно искаш да направиш, ама да видим дали ще ти помогна. Най елементарния начин е с match. Ако искаш да сравниш колона в sheet1 с колона l sheet2 функцията ти е следната:
match(a1;Sheet2!a$1$:a$30000$;0) . В клетката в която ти е формулата има два варианта на резултат - или някакво число или #N/A . Ако резултата е число например 5, значи че търсеното число/текст.. го има в другия списък на 5 ред. Ако не е число съответно го няма. За да ги махнеш тези дето ги няма най лесно пусни един филтър само с тези, които са #N/A и изтрий редовете.
А дано съм бил полезен
match(a1;Sheet2!a$1$:a$30000$;0) . В клетката в която ти е формулата има два варианта на резултат - или някакво число или #N/A . Ако резултата е число например 5, значи че търсеното число/текст.. го има в другия списък на 5 ред. Ако не е число съответно го няма. За да ги махнеш тези дето ги няма най лесно пусни един филтър само с тези, които са #N/A и изтрий редовете.
А дано съм бил полезен
-
- Мнения: 178
- Регистриран на: Чет 26 яну 2006 18:24
- Автомобил: VW MK4
- Двигател: ATD PD TDI
- Местоположение: Русе
Re: Въпрос за Excel
Аз имам въпрос относно подреждане по определен признак, в случая име.
Имам данни от 12 месеца, вид разход и стойност в две отделни клетки за всеки месец.
Искам да ги подредя като месеците са хоризонтално / настрани / от 1-12 и стойностите на разходите надолу по вертикала.
Проблема е, че ако поставя в колони една до друга, редовете не съвпадат. Надолу по вертикала са около 100. Има ли начин за подредба по име и стойност, съответно в някои месеци някои някои видове разходи липсват - там трябва да има празно място ...
Имам данни от 12 месеца, вид разход и стойност в две отделни клетки за всеки месец.
Искам да ги подредя като месеците са хоризонтално / настрани / от 1-12 и стойностите на разходите надолу по вертикала.
Проблема е, че ако поставя в колони една до друга, редовете не съвпадат. Надолу по вертикала са около 100. Има ли начин за подредба по име и стойност, съответно в някои месеци някои някои видове разходи липсват - там трябва да има празно място ...
Re: Въпрос за Excel
в какъв формат/вид/таблица са ти данните, с които ще работиш? структурирани ли са в една база?
pivot таблица ще ти свърши ли работа?
(ако е това от картинката, би трябвало да стане. Прочети малко в google за функциите на пивота и ще се оправиш. С него можеш всякакви разрези на данните да правиш).
pivot таблица ще ти свърши ли работа?
(ако е това от картинката, би трябвало да стане. Прочети малко в google за функциите на пивота и ще се оправиш. С него можеш всякакви разрези на данните да правиш).
-
- Мнения: 178
- Регистриран на: Чет 26 яну 2006 18:24
- Автомобил: VW MK4
- Двигател: ATD PD TDI
- Местоположение: Русе
Re: Въпрос за Excel
Пивоти правя, за да обобщя данни по определен критерии.
В случая мога да обобщя сумите на отделните разходи по име / сборуване / , а не искам това. Искам да ги подредя.
Не знам как с пивот ще стане, ао е възможно може ли малко по - конкретно.
В случая мога да обобщя сумите на отделните разходи по име / сборуване / , а не искам това. Искам да ги подредя.
Не знам как с пивот ще стане, ао е възможно може ли малко по - конкретно.
Re: Въпрос за Excel
в момента не разбирам точно какво искаш да поиска, но пивот-а освен че обобщава прави и много други неща. Примерно можеш да го ползваш и за преподредба на данните.
Примерната таблица, която си дал, е 14 колони и 3 реда. Пивотът ще я обърне без проблем с два клика. Отдолу обаче пишеш за 100 реда по вертикала, не ми става ясно кои редове не съвпадат ... каква точно е информацията с която раполагаш и каква е целта?
Примерната таблица, която си дал, е 14 колони и 3 реда. Пивотът ще я обърне без проблем с два клика. Отдолу обаче пишеш за 100 реда по вертикала, не ми става ясно кои редове не съвпадат ... каква точно е информацията с която раполагаш и каква е целта?
-
- Мнения: 178
- Регистриран на: Чет 26 яну 2006 18:24
- Автомобил: VW MK4
- Двигател: ATD PD TDI
- Местоположение: Русе
Re: Въпрос за Excel
Редовете надолу са много , няма как да ги сложа тук, оставих само първите 3.
За всеки месец от януари до декември имам разход със стойност.
Проблема е , че са разбъркани.
Ако поставя един до друг януари с колони разход / стойност до февруари с колони разход / стойност редовете не съвпадат. Например канцеларски от първия месец ще застане до емулсия от февруари.
Как да ги подредя ?
За всеки месец от януари до декември имам разход със стойност.
Проблема е , че са разбъркани.
Ако поставя един до друг януари с колони разход / стойност до февруари с колони разход / стойност редовете не съвпадат. Например канцеларски от първия месец ще застане до емулсия от февруари.
Как да ги подредя ?
Последна промяна от IvanMan на Пон 20 май 2019 12:43, променено общо 1 път.
Причина: Не е необходимо да цитираш предишното мнение! Използвай бутон нов "отговор"!
Причина: Не е необходимо да цитираш предишното мнение! Използвай бутон нов "отговор"!
Re: Въпрос за Excel
не мога да разбера, съжалявам.
това, което си показал горе е това, което искаш да постигнеш като краен резултат, така ли?
дай една снимка сега на входните данни, горе-долу как изглеждат. Ама поне 10-тина реда.
това, което си показал горе е това, което искаш да постигнеш като краен резултат, така ли?
дай една снимка сега на входните данни, горе-долу как изглеждат. Ама поне 10-тина реда.
-
- Мнения: 178
- Регистриран на: Чет 26 яну 2006 18:24
- Автомобил: VW MK4
- Двигател: ATD PD TDI
- Местоположение: Русе
Re: Въпрос за Excel
Виждам, че искаш да помогнеш, благодаря.
Първите 2 реда съвпадат в 4-те месеца. По - надолу се разместват. Искам да ги подредя , това е.
Първите 2 реда съвпадат в 4-те месеца. По - надолу се разместват. Искам да ги подредя , това е.
Re: Въпрос за Excel
записана по този начин тази информация не може да се обработи от пивот
Бих ти препоръчал да събереш всичко в една таблица/база, която да поддържаш, така че да може да се обработва лесно от пивот-а. Ако трябва и няколко различни пивот-а ще си направиш. които да ти вадят необходимите отчети, но базата ще е една (лесна за поддръжка).
Примерно нещо такова:
по твое желение можеш да добавиш нови колони за категория на разхода (материали, канцеларски, производствени), дата, ден, месец, година и тн. Всяка колона ти позволява да сортираш, филтрираш по нея.
слагам и един примерен резултат от пивота (каквато мисля, че е целта).
Бих ти препоръчал да събереш всичко в една таблица/база, която да поддържаш, така че да може да се обработва лесно от пивот-а. Ако трябва и няколко различни пивот-а ще си направиш. които да ти вадят необходимите отчети, но базата ще е една (лесна за поддръжка).
Примерно нещо такова:
по твое желение можеш да добавиш нови колони за категория на разхода (материали, канцеларски, производствени), дата, ден, месец, година и тн. Всяка колона ти позволява да сортираш, филтрираш по нея.
слагам и един примерен резултат от пивота (каквато мисля, че е целта).
- Прикачени файлове
-
- Capture1.JPG (37.03 KиБ) Видяна 4837 пъти
-
- Capture3.JPG (25.04 KиБ) Видяна 4837 пъти
Върни се в “ОФФ-Топик - други”
Кой е на линия
Потребители, разглеждащи този форум: Няма регистрирани потребители и 40 госта